# 加密流量解密过程增加检测系统延迟:问题分析与AI技术解决方案
## 引言
随着互联网的迅猛发展,网络安全问题日益突出。加密技术在保护数据传输安全方面发挥了重要作用,但也给网络安全检测带来了新的挑战。加密流量的解密过程增加了检测系统的延迟,影响了实时监控和响应的效率。本文将详细分析这一问题,并探讨如何利用AI技术有效解决。
## 一、加密流量解密过程的挑战
### 1.1 加密流量的普及
近年来,HTTPS、VPN等加密技术的广泛应用,使得网络流量中加密部分的比例大幅增加。据统计,全球超过80%的网络流量已实现加密。加密技术虽然有效保护了数据隐私,但也给网络安全检测带来了新的难题。
### 1.2 解密过程的复杂性
加密流量的解密需要消耗大量的计算资源。对称加密和非对称加密算法的复杂度不同,但无论是哪种加密方式,解密过程都需要进行大量的数学运算。这不仅增加了系统的计算负担,还延长了数据处理的时间。
### 1.3 解密对检测延迟的影响
在网络安全检测系统中,实时性是至关重要的。解密过程的存在使得数据在进入检测引擎之前需要经过额外的处理步骤,这无疑增加了系统的整体延迟。特别是在高流量环境下,解密延迟可能导致恶意攻击行为无法被及时识别和阻断。
## 二、AI技术在网络安全中的应用
### 2.1 AI技术的优势
AI技术在处理大规模数据和复杂模式识别方面具有显著优势。通过机器学习和深度学习算法,AI能够从海量数据中提取有价值的信息,并进行高效的分类和预测。
### 2.2 AI在网络安全检测中的应用场景
#### 2.2.1 异常检测
AI可以通过分析网络流量特征,识别出异常行为。例如,基于流量大小、频率、来源IP等特征,AI模型可以判断是否存在DDoS攻击、恶意软件传播等威胁。
#### 2.2.2 恶意代码识别
AI技术可以用于恶意代码的静态和动态分析。通过训练模型识别恶意代码的特征,AI能够在不解密的情况下,快速判断文件的安全性。
#### 2.2.3 行为分析
AI可以对用户和系统的行为进行建模,识别出异常行为模式。例如,通过分析用户的登录时间、访问路径等,AI可以判断是否存在账户盗用风险。
## 三、加密流量解密延迟问题的AI解决方案
### 3.1 基于AI的流量分类
#### 3.1.1 流量特征提取
在不解密的情况下,AI可以通过分析流量的元数据(如IP地址、端口号、流量大小等)和统计特征(如流量分布、包大小分布等),提取出用于分类的特征。
#### 3.1.2 分类模型训练
利用提取的特征,训练分类模型(如决策树、支持向量机、神经网络等),将流量分为正常流量和潜在威胁流量。这样可以减少需要解密的流量比例,降低解密过程的负担。
### 3.2 AI辅助的解密优化
#### 3.2.1 解密优先级调度
基于AI的流量分类结果,可以对不同类别的流量设置不同的解密优先级。例如,将潜在威胁流量优先解密,而正常流量可以延后处理,从而优化系统的整体性能。
#### 3.2.2 解密资源动态分配
利用AI技术实时监控系统的资源使用情况,动态调整解密资源的分配。在高流量时段,AI可以智能地增加解密资源,而在低流量时段则减少资源占用,确保系统的稳定运行。
### 3.3 AI驱动的异常检测
#### 3.3.1 特征工程
在不解密的情况下,AI可以通过分析流量的统计特征和行为特征,构建用于异常检测的特征向量。例如,流量的时间序列特征、流量模式的变化等。
#### 3.3.2 异常检测模型
利用构建的特征向量,训练异常检测模型(如孤立森林、自编码器等),实时监测流量的异常情况。一旦检测到异常,系统可以立即触发报警,并进行进一步的调查和处理。
### 3.4 AI与加密技术的结合
#### 3.4.1 homomorphic encryption(同态加密)
同态加密技术允许在加密数据上进行计算,而不需要解密。结合AI技术,可以在不解密的情况下对数据进行分析和处理,从而避免解密带来的延迟问题。
#### 3.4.2 Secure Multi-Party Computation(安全多方计算)
安全多方计算技术可以在不泄露数据内容的情况下,进行多方协作计算。结合AI技术,可以实现多方数据的安全共享和分析,提高检测系统的效率和安全性。
## 四、案例分析
### 4.1 案例一:某大型企业的网络安全检测系统
某大型企业在部署网络安全检测系统时,面临加密流量解密延迟的问题。通过引入AI技术,企业实现了流量的智能分类和优先级调度,显著降低了系统的整体延迟。具体实施步骤如下:
1. **流量特征提取**:利用AI技术提取流量的元数据和统计特征。
2. **分类模型训练**:训练决策树模型,将流量分为高、中、低风险等级。
3. **解密优先级调度**:根据分类结果,优先解密高风险流量,延后处理低风险流量。
实施后,系统的检测延迟降低了30%,恶意攻击的识别率提高了20%。
### 4.2 案例二:某网络安全服务提供商的AI驱动检测平台
某网络安全服务提供商在其检测平台中引入了AI驱动的异常检测技术,有效解决了加密流量解密延迟问题。具体实施步骤如下:
1. **特征工程**:在不解密的情况下,提取流量的时间序列特征和行为特征。
2. **异常检测模型训练**:训练自编码器模型,实时监测流量的异常情况。
3. **报警和响应**:一旦检测到异常,系统立即触发报警,并进行自动化的响应处理。
实施后,平台的检测延迟降低了25%,异常行为的识别率提高了15%。
## 五、未来展望
### 5.1 技术发展趋势
随着AI技术的不断进步,其在网络安全领域的应用将更加广泛和深入。未来,AI技术有望在以下几个方面取得突破:
1. **更高效的流量分类算法**:通过改进算法和优化模型结构,提高流量分类的准确性和效率。
2. **更智能的解密优化策略**:利用AI技术实现更精细化的解密资源调度和分配。
3. **更强大的异常检测能力**:通过引入更先进的AI模型,提高异常检测的灵敏度和准确性。
### 5.2 应用前景
AI技术在网络安全领域的应用前景广阔。未来,AI技术将不仅在加密流量解密延迟问题上发挥重要作用,还将在恶意代码检测、入侵检测、威胁情报分析等多个方面展现出强大的潜力。
## 结论
加密流量解密过程增加检测系统延迟是当前网络安全领域面临的重要挑战。通过引入AI技术,可以实现流量的智能分类、解密优化和异常检测,有效降低系统的整体延迟,提高检测效率和准确性。未来,随着AI技术的不断发展和应用,网络安全检测系统将更加智能化和高效化,为保障网络安全提供强有力的技术支撑。
---
本文通过对加密流量解密延迟问题的深入分析,结合AI技术的应用场景,提出了详实的解决方案,旨在为网络安全领域的从业者提供有益的参考和借鉴。希望本文的研究能够推动网络安全技术的进步,为构建更加安全的网络环境贡献力量。